Hit-and-run victim gives birth
A woman who was run over by a car after soon finding out she was pregnant, has given birth to a healthy baby daughter.
Amy Edgecumbe was hit by a car on a night out with boyfriend Mathew Rippin, in Hull, on December 27 last year.
As she lay bleeding, the driver stopped briefly, but then drove off.
The 19-year-old suffered a shattered arm, fractured hip and bruising to the brain. She still has the tyre marks on her stomach. But now she has a healthy daughter Lily-Mae.
Amy said: "I feel lucky to be alive and so relieved about my baby. She is fantastic . . . absolutely perfect."
She added: "The driver's front wheel went over my stomach, then his back wheel. It ripped my skin.
"It was terrifying wondering whether my baby would die or be crippled. A hospital scan showed everything was alright - but there was always a nagging doubt."
A teenager was later fined £100 for failing to report an accident, says The Sun.
